Output 623bbe33684c47eac82b22268031e73e3aa827eebecb53fa472c9dfe6ad6b622:1

value
44285580
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d153450351530e98f3edfc3dfefb3654036671f9 OP_EQUALVERIFY OP_CHECKSIG
address
1L5oymLu8oLdt4GWxowKSwRisZ6tswRQWk
transaction
623bbe33684c47eac82b22268031e73e3aa827eebecb53fa472c9dfe6ad6b622
spent
true